It occurred one summer season night time at Basin Avenue West in San Francisco. The Ramsey Lewis Trio, fronted by the late and esteemed keyboard virtuoso from Chicago, have been in the home.

The viewers have been primed, and so was the recording gear. That night, a superb and intimate stay album was created, and named after a Motown traditional. Lewis’ trendy reimagining of Martha and the Vandellas’ “Dancing In The Street” preceded the LP as a single and entered the Billboard Scorching 100 on September 23, 1967.

Lewis’ compadres on stage that night time made for an impressive-looking trio, as each different gamers went on to nice acclaim of their later careers. Bassist Cleveland Eaton would entrance his personal band and information, from 1973 onwards, discovering a lot success within the funk and disco fields and later working with the Rely Basie Orchestra.

A future star drummer

The drummer, in the meantime, was none apart from Maurice White, who had taken over from Isaac “Red” Holt in 1966, when Holt had left to kind Younger-Holt Limitless with bassist Eldee Younger. It hardly want saying that White later turned one of the crucial vital group leaders in soul music, as frontman with the nice Earth, Wind & Fireplace.

When it comes to their recording profession, Lewis and the trio might have been mainly an album act. However they’d tasted substantial singles recognition amongst each R&B and pop audiences. In 1965, their celebrated refit of Dobie Grey’s “The ‘In’ Crowd” rose to No.2 on the soul chart and No.5 pop, and was swiftly adopted by a brand new model of the McCoys’ “Hang On Sloopy,” at Nos.6 and 11 respectively.

As Lewis dropped the trio identify to document in solely his personal, the validation continued with one other of his signatures, “Wade In The Water.” That No.3 R&B 45 went to No.19 on the Scorching 100. The pianist’s mellifluous and distinctive strategy might, it appeared, be turned to virtually any modern monitor, as he would later show by, improbably, taking a rendition of The Beatles‘ “Julia” into the soul Top 40 in 1969. It wasn’t his first go to to Liverpool, both, having had a Prime 30 pop single with “A Hard Day’s Night” again in 1966.

Dancing in direction of an album

Lewis’ tackle “Dancing In The Street” didn’t make the soul listings, but it surely entered the Scorching 100 at No.92, within the week that the Field Tops climbed to No.1 with “The Letter.” The Motown re-do didn’t final lengthy, peaking at No.84 in a four-week run, but it surely additionally turned a Prime 40 success on the Grownup Modern chart and paved the way in which for the album of the identical identify.

On October 28, and that includes different assured covers similar to “You Don’t Know Me” and “What Now My Love,” the Dancing In The Avenue stay album entered the all-genre LP chart, rising to No.59 in a 16-week run. It spent 10 weeks on the soul countdown for Lewis and co, peaking at No.16.
